(Kaieteur News) – America! America! America! America is on a roll. Can’t make a misstep. Unable to do any wrong. In the right place, and in the money. Venezuela. From savaging sanctions that dispatched the citizens of a pariah state all over, to soothing symphonies of help. America taking the lead. Many countries feared to whisper the name Venezuela up to a few months ago. They are now rushing forward with good intentions, and a heart of gold. Above them all, stand the USA. Even in a time of Venezuelan national tragedy, the damage of which will take some time to assess, the U.S. holds the cards, will benefit still more. I begin at the beginning.
There’s that big, bubbling, beauty: the splash of 300 billion barrels. Who cares about thicker and bitter? Business for Exxon and Chevron. Business for oil refineries in Louisiana and others around that square. Recall what I said: America in the money. From oil, there is oil infrastructure. Rehabilitation is a little on the tame side. Try a complete overhaul, with new technology and architecture. Go the whole nine yards, and wander over decayed, dilapidated nonoil physical infrastructure. A cool trillion (American) is taking shape. Business, business, business. The U.S. industrial complex can’t do all the work. Some small jobs should trickledown to countries that are given the greenlight by DJ Trump’s men on the ground in Caracas. China can continue to rearrange the sphere on its side of the world. The U.S. is busy anticipating and well along with its moves to rearrange matters to its own advantage this side of the globe.
Sanctions lifted. Venezuelans lifted. Lest I neglect, Wall Street sharks lift themselves from their skyscrapers in Manhattan and travel to the magic in Lakes Maracaibo and Orinoco. From oilmen to moneymen. From builders to bankers. Those who don’t have a New York accent are sure to have a good ole down home Texas twang. But there is still more to those trillion-dollar plus enchantments in Venezuela. For out of catastrophe and adversity come opportunity and prosperity. And who is best positioned, who has the controlling say, of who is in and who shouldn’t bother to show their faces? The good ole USA and DJ Trump. Business is business, and post-earthquake business pays with the same kind of currency.
Though the damage is not yet fully known, a decent estimate is that there are heavy billions that will be needed to repair the damage, get Venezuela back on its feet again. Its credit is the best. For there is nothing that can beat the collateral of 300 billion barrels. Plus, a signoff from a newly benevolent Uncle Sam. Money begets more money. America is the living embodiment of that state. Its US$40 trillion debt spiral given its proper consideration. Simply look at where and how it is perched in Caracas. Calling the shots. Dictating the flow. Oil billions. Banking billions. Road billions. Billions for this, that, and the thorough. And now to top all those, there are earthquake related billions. Truly, it doesn’t rain, it pours.
Look who is there with a hanky for tears and balms for pain. America. Look at others following the leader, and setting foot out of the woodwork. A hearty hand for Venezuela in its time of turbulence and more trouble. America’s backyard is now its front lawn. The white tables, the comforting chairs, the glistening silver, all speak of the treasures of this hemisphere long yearned for, now all in hand. Nobody is rocking the SS America. No one is stepping out of line. A Trumpian leader in Columbia. Venezuela and Guyana in the bag, and labouring under their yokes of Washington’s command and control. Trinidad making clear where its heart is. Guyana, as usual, playing at the shifty. Working overtime to give the impression of being savvy. Still possessing some potency of its own. Indeed, the domino theory has come to past, but with a difference. The dominoes have all fallen America’s way.
